    I am a Baptist but have a problem with tithing (Malachi 3:10). It is mentioned in the Old Testament, but not as a mandate in the New Testament. To Christians: Can you please explain why we are supposed to tithe, according to the New Testament? I’d prefer answers that are Bible based, not necessarily what you have heard.

    As far as I know, there is nothing in the New Testament that requires a 10 percent tithe, though St. Paul does say in one of his epistles that Christians should support the local church. How much is never specified, though.
